| Indicator | 2017 | 2018 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| GDP (Current USD) | $2.31 billion | $2.56 billion | +10.82% |
| GDP per Capita | $1,069.37 | $1,170.66 | +9.47% |
| GDP Growth (Annual %) | -3.14% | -1.48% | +1.66pp |
| Inflation (CPI %) | 4.45% | 4.75% | +0.30pp |
| Unemployment Rate (%) | 16.40% | 16.63% | +0.22pp |
